Brief Introduction: 1. GMDC:

Gujarat Mineral Development GMDC Limited (GMDC), a Government of Gujarat Enterprise, is a pioneer institution in the field of mining for more than three decades, catering to the needs of the minerals and solid fuel for the industries based in and outside Gujarat. GMDC’s mining activities are spread over in Kutch, Jamnagar, Bhavnagar, Bharuch, Baroda and Banaskantha districts of the State. It is currently dealing in minerals like Bauxite, Fluorspar, Ball Clay, Silica sand and Lignite. The GMDC has also set up a 250 MW lignite based Thermal Power Station at Nani Chher in Kutch, Wind power of 100 MW at Maliya, Jodiya, Godsar and Solar Power plant of 5 MW at Panandhro Project. GMDC is operating Lignite mines, Panandhro and Mata-No-Madh in Kutch, Rajpardi in Bharuch district, Tadkeshwar in Surat District and Bhavnagar in Bhavnagar District.

2. Location

The Bhavnagar Project (Tagadi village) is located about 12 kms from Bhavnagar in Dist. Bhavnagar (Gujarat State). The nearest Railway Station and Airport are located at a distance of about 12-20 kms. resp. from the lease area at Bhavnagar.

3. Description of the Work:

GMDC proposes to engage contractor to break the hard strata encountered during excavation of overburden and above lignite seams at Bhavnagar lignite Mine. The approximate quantity to be broken during the currency of the contract is approx. 42 lac M3. The thickness of the hard strata ranges from 1.00 meter to 7.0 meter depending upon the location.

4. Current Status:-

This mine is in operation since last 2008 and its production capacity is about 3 million tonnes per year. The lignite production from Bhavnagar lignite mine in the year 2011-12 was 21.02 lac tones.

5. METHOD OF MINING It is proposed to work the mine by opencast mining method, using conventional mining machinery like Rock breaker. The overburden lying over the hard strata will be removed by the existing agency working at the mines and top of the hard strata will be exposed.

17. MEASUREMENTS

OB/IB removal work: - Measurements of work of breaking of the hard strata shall be made using Total Survey Stations. The field readings shall be directly transferred to computer software for computation of volumes and preparation of plans and sections. Datamine or any other suitable software shall be used for this purpose. An authorized representative of the bidder shall remain present at the time of field measurement and computation work and will also certify the same. The measurement and the computations provided by the Management shall be

final and binding to the bidder and on the basis of this measured quantity the payment shall be made to the successful bidder.

18. LIQUIDATED DAMAGES (L.D.)

a) If the Successful bidder fails to mobilise the machinery and manpower to commence the work within within 15 days from the date of acceptance

of LOI., as, as required under clause no.9 of Chapter-II of tender document, a penalty @ Rs.15, 000/- per day shall be leviable, for a maximum period of 20 days. If the successful bidder fails to start work even after 20 days, the GMDC will be free to forfeit the EMD and take action stipulated under Clause No.2 (e) of Chapter-VI of tender document. The liquidated damages shall be recovered from the monthly RA Bill.

b) The Liquidated damages shall be leviable after end of every month on the shortfall quantity in the monthly targeted quantity of the hard strata to be broken, for the relevant RA Bill period at the following rates:

Shortfall in the actual quantity Rate for Liquidated damages

for shortfall quantity Up to 5% of the monthly target Nil More than 5% and up to 15% of the monthly target

10% of the contract rate per Cubic Meter.

More than 15% of the monthly target

15% of the contract rate per Cubic Meter.

c) However, shortfall/excess in the annual targeted quantities shall be reviewed at the end of every year and if the CONTRACTOR meets the
